Unveiled: Callaway FTiZ fairway wood

Published:

Callaway’s new FTiZ fairway wood is the latest in the line of the company’s FT (fusion technology) clubs to incorporate a mix of materials in the head for improved performance.

While multi-material technology is more prevalent in drivers, Callaway has used it to take fairway wood development to the next level and incorporate a Polar Weighting system to the new clubs.

This means a mix of titanium, carbon fibre, aluminium and steel has all been fused together in the head to result in a heavier face, heavy rear weighting and an ultra-light mid section for a high MOI and more stability throughout the strike.

The result, say Callaway, is a high launching but solid club with plenty of built-in forgiveness.

This technology doesn’t come cheap. The FTiZ fairway woods are priced at £249 but in today’s world you usually get what you pay for.
